Why Fall Is Open Enrolment Season for Group Benefits

Why Fall Is Open Enrolment Season for Group Benefits

Open enrolment is the period when employees can review, update, or make changes to their group benefits plans. Outside of this window, changes are usually limited to life events such as marriage, the birth of a child, or other qualifying circumstances.
